Kseniya Alexandrova's sudden death has sent shockwaves through the beauty pageant and modeling communities. Alexandrova, who represented Russia at the Miss Universe 2017 pageant, was known for her grace, beauty, and dedication.
The accident occurred on July 5th while Alexandrova and her husband were driving home from Rzhev. An elk suddenly jumped onto the road and collided with their car. Alexandrova, who was in the passenger seat, sustained severe head injuries. Her husband survived the accident.
After the accident, Alexandrova was immediately transported to a hospital in Moscow, where she remained in a coma for over a month. Despite the efforts of medical professionals, she succumbed to her injuries on August 12th.
Alexandrova's modeling agency, Modus Vivendis, confirmed her death in a statement, describing her as a symbol of beauty, kindness, and inner strength. The Miss Universe Organization also shared a tribute, remembering her unforgettable mark on the Miss Universe family.
Beyond her beauty pageant career, Alexandrova was a practicing psychologist, having earned a degree from Moscow Pedagogical State University. She also worked as a television host. Her diverse accomplishments reflected her intelligence, ambition, and desire to make a positive impact on the world.
